Global Ship Lease Issues Inaugural Environmental Social and Governance (ESG) Report
September 9, 2020
Company Also Launches New Corporate Website
LONDON, Sept. 09, 2020 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Global Ship Lease, Inc. (NYSE:GSL) (the “Company”), a leading independent owner of containerships, announced today that it has issued its inaugural Environmental, Social, and Governance (“ESG”) report. The ESG report outlines the Company’s maritime sustainability strategy and targets, as well as current ESG policies and performance.
George Youroukos, Executive Chairman of Global Ship Lease, commented, “We are proud to issue our first ESG report and to provide investors and other stakeholders with additional insight into this important aspect of our business. Whilst not formalized until recently, and although we will continue to strive to do better, a number of ESG principles have long been embedded in our company culture and the way we do business. For example, taking Global Ship Lease together with Technomar and ConChart, our technical and commercial management partners, we have an inclusive workplace that features women in more than 40% of shore-based roles - including as head of chartering, head of legal, head of insurance, and head of accounting. Through the additional transparency and accountability of regular ESG reporting, our active participation in initiatives such as the Getting To Zero Coalition, an organization aiming to bring commercially viable, zero-emissions vessels into operation by 2030, and by creating a new and separate ESG committee at the Board level, we are committed to ensuring that Global Ship Lease remains a driver of this important movement in a way that ensures our long-term success in an evolving market.”
Global Ship Lease’s inaugural 2019 ESG report will be available on the Company’s new corporate website, www.globalshiplease.com, which launched today.
About Global Ship Lease
Global Ship Lease is a leading independent owner of containerships with a diversified fleet of mid-sized and smaller containerships. Incorporated in the Marshall Islands, Global Ship Lease commenced operations in December 2007 with a business of owning and chartering out containerships under fixed-rate charters to top tier container liner companies. On November 15, 2018, it completed a strategic combination with Poseidon Containers.
Global Ship Lease owns 43 containerships, ranging from 2,207 to 11,040 TEU, of which nine are fuel-efficient new-design wide-beam, with a total capacity of 245,280 TEU and an average age, weighted by TEU capacity, of 13.2 years as at June 30, 2020.
Adjusted to include all charters agreed, and ships acquired or divested, up to August 06, 2020, the average remaining term of the Company’s charters at June 30, 2020, to the mid-point of redelivery, including options under the Company’s control, was 2.3 years on a TEU-weighted basis. Contracted revenue on the same basis was $659.1 million. Contracted revenue was $743.6 million, including options under charterers’ control and with latest redelivery date, representing a weighted average remaining term of 2.6 years.

Global Ship Lease Declares Quarterly Dividend on its 8.75% Series B Cumulative Redeemable Perpetual Preferred Shares
September 8, 2020
LONDON, Sept. 08, 2020 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Global Ship Lease, Inc. (NYSE:GSL) (the “Company”) announced today that the Company’s Board of Directors has declared a cash dividend of $0.546875 per depositary share, each representing a 1/100th interest in a share of its 8.75% Series B Cumulative Redeemable Perpetual Preferred Shares (the “Series B Preferred Shares”) (NYSE:GSLPrB). The dividend represents payment for the period from July 1, 2020 to September 30, 2020 and will be paid on October 1, 2020 to all Series B Preferred Shareholders of record as of September 24, 2020.
